Osita Iheme’s Biography

Actor Osita Iheme was born in Nigeria on February 20, 1982. He is recognized for costarring with Chinedu Ikedieze in the movie Aki na Ukwa as Pawpaw. His on-screen interaction with Chinedu has been the subject of memes on Twitter and other social media platforms since 2019.

[image-2]

Osita Iheme frequently played the part of a child, a trend that persisted until his adult years. Osita Iheme started Inspired Movement Africa to uplift, encourage, and educate young people in Africa and Nigeria. Iheme won the African Movie Academy Awards Lifetime Achievement Award in 2007.

He is regarded as one of Nigeria’s most well-known actors. As a result, President Goodluck Jonathan awarded Osita Iheme the title of Member of the Order of the Federal Republic in 2011. Nowadays, he is not only a popular figure in Nigeria. Instead, he is recognized worldwide because the meme community uses his clip from a 2002 movie in meme format on several occasions.

Osita Iheme Wife And Family Life

Osita is one of the talented actors who have come from Nigeria. He plays dwarf characters with such comic timing that it is impossible to resist laughing while watching him. His parents are Herbert Iheme and Augustine Iheme, from Nigeria. Unfortunately, he didn’t share many details about his personal life, so other information about his parents is unavailable now.

[image-3]

The Nigerian actor is still unmarried at the age of 40. According to several interviews with the actor, he doesn’t seem to be getting married soon. However, he is linked with a woman named Noma, with whom he is believed to have a kid. His Wikipedia page has mentioned Noma as his spouse, but top Nigerian portals have cited him as an unmarried person. So it is still unclear about his relationship status.
